Canyon climbers know fitness can be fun.

For those who prefer their exercise with a fair amount of adventure thrown in, the canyons found in Georgia State Parks do not disappoint! It's here that the true benefit of healthy, outdoor exercise is revealed: workouts are a lot more enjoyable when you're surrounded by 360 degrees of spectacular beauty! When the goal is to get to the top of an amazing trail, most people forget to even count the steps! And Georgia boasts a whole handful of these natural wonders just waiting to be conquered!   

You may want  to check out Georgia’s new Canyon Climbers Club, which challenges members to scale the height of Amicalola Falls, explore the depths of Providence Canyon, brave the swinging bridge in Tallulah Gorge and face the daunting staircase in Cloudland Canyon. Members who complete these challenges earn a club t-shirt. Sound more exciting than an exercise video?

To join the Canyon Climbers Club, hikers should stop by one of the four participating state park offices and purchase a $10 membership card, call (770) 389-7401 or send an email with your name, address and daytime phone number to: Anissa.Carter@gadnr.org.

Please note: A healthy dose of enthusiasm and sturdy hiking boots are recommended. No time limit applies, so hikers can take as long as they wish to visit all four parks.
